Mud pumping service involves injecting a specialized mixture of soil, water, and sometimes additives beneath the surface of a property to stabilize the ground. This process helps lift and level sunken or uneven areas, restoring the stability of the soil and preventing further settling. It is a practical solution often used in residential settings where the ground has shifted due to natural causes, poor soil conditions, or previous construction activities. By carefully applying mud pumping techniques, experienced contractors can effectively improve the surface integrity of driveways, walkways, patios, and other outdoor surfaces.
This service is particularly useful for addressing problems such as cracked or uneven concrete slabs, sinking sidewalks, or sunken patios. Over time, soil beneath these structures can settle or wash away, leading to dangerous tripping hazards or damage to the property’s appearance. Mud pumping helps lift these surfaces back to their original position, reducing the risk of further deterioration. It also provides a cost-effective alternative to complete replacement, especially when the underlying soil issues are the primary cause of surface movement.

What is mud pumping service used for? Mud pumping is used to stabilize and reinforce soil around foundations, tunnels, or underground structures by injecting a mixture of water and soil to fill voids and strengthen the ground.
How do local contractors perform mud pumping? Contractors typically drill into the ground at specific points, then inject the mud mixture under pressure to fill voids, lift settled areas, and improve soil stability.
What types of projects benefit from mud pumping? Mud pumping is often used for foundation repair, basement stabilization, and soil reinforcement for new construction projects in areas with loose or unstable soil.
Are there different methods of mud pumping? Yes, methods vary based on the project, including slurry injection, grout injection, or other soil stabilization techniques performed by local service providers.
